He Chose Another Woman, So I Divorced Him And Disappeared With My Daugther

Gweneth's seven-year marriage to Darius Reeds becomes a nightmare when he forces her and their daughter, Laina, into the servants' quarters. To appease Clara, an amnesiac woman, Darius publicly humiliates Gwen, labeling her a mistress and their child an illegitimate secret. After Clara injures Laina and Darius breaks Gwen's wrist to protect his pregnant companion, Gwen decides she has had enough. She quietly files for divorce, determined to disappear forever and watch him break when the truth is revealed.

Chapter 7

After a moment, she slumped limply before finally passing out, tears streaming from the corners of her eyes.

Gwen was left alone in that chair without food or water until the next day.

Gwen woke up when a nurse approached her, clicking her tongue in disgust.

“Goodness, it stinks.” She waved her hand and said with a cold smile. “Before we continue with therapy, Mrs. Clara wants me to show you something.”

The nurse pulled out her phone and played a video right in front of Gwen’s face.

Gwen’s heart seemed to stop beating when she saw Laina’s face appear on the screen. The little girl was crying on her bed, her tiny body trembling with fear.

Clara then appeared in the video. The injured side of her face was covered in thick bandages, staring at Laina with a cold gaze.

Without a shred of mercy, Clara grabbed Laina’s small hair, then pinched her arm and struck the poor child’s back until Laina’s shrill screams pierced the recording.

“Shut up, you damn brat! You’re just as annoying as your mother!” Clara snapped.

She then turned directly toward the phone camera, smiling mockingly as if she were looking straight at Gwen.

“Look, Gwen, how easy it was to make Darius hand over everything you own to me. He didn’t even do a thing while I made your beloved daughter cry in pain. Your husband and daughter are now mine. While you’re locked up forever in a psychiatric hospital.”

“LAINA! DON'T TOUCH MY DAUGHTER!" Gwen screamed hysterically. She thrashed about frantically until the leather strap binding her cut into her wrists. Fresh blood began to flow freely.

Seeing Gwen’s shattered state, the nurse let her guard down. She set the syringe filled with a high-dose sedative on the nightstand, then turned away indifferently to fetch an extra rope from the corner cabinet.

That was a fatal mistake. Driven by rage and a mother’s instinct, Gwen tore the skin on her hand, using her own blood as lubrication to force her hand free from the belt’s grip.

Rip! Her hand was free.

Before the nurse could fully turn around, Gwen snatched the syringe from the nightstand and plunged it directly into the nurse’s neck. The sedative was forced out completely, leaving no residue.

The nurse’s eyes widened before she finally collapsed unconscious onto the floor.

Gwen’s breath was ragged. She immediately grabbed the phone containing evidence of her son’s torture, then snatched the cell key from the nurse’s waist.

Quickly, she opened the isolation room door, ran down the corridor, and fled through the hospital’s rear emergency exit.

She managed to reach the house she had long since abandoned via a secret path.

The house, once built for her small family, now loomed coldly before her.

The atmosphere was silent. Darius’s car wasn’t in the driveway. Based on information she’d overheard from the security guard’s conversation, Darius was out having dinner with Clara to comfort her over her miscarriage, and all the staff were off duty.

Gwen ran into the room she recognized. “Laina? Sweetheart, it’s Mom!”

Silence. No answer.

Gwen checked the messy bedroom, but Laina wasn’t there. Her daughter’s tattered rabbit doll lay abandoned on the floor leading to the main bathroom. A sense of foreboding struck Gwen’s chest like a sledgehammer.

She walked slowly toward the bathroom. The heavy wooden door was slightly ajar, revealing cold steam creeping across the floor.

The sound of water overflowing from the bathtub was rhythmic, splashing against the tiles with a torturous tick... tick... tick... sound.

“Laina?” Gwen’s voice barely came out.

Gwen pushed the door all the way open. Her eyes widened instantly, and her breath caught in her throat.

Inside the large bathtub filled with overflowing water, Laina—her little daughter—had drowned. Her favorite white dress spread out in the water like the wings of a fallen angel. Her soft black hair partially covered her face.

“No… no, sweetheart… wake up…”

Gwen collapsed to her knees. Her hands trembled violently as she reached for her daughter’s tiny, ice-cold body. She lifted Laina into her arms. Water drenched Gwen’s entire body, but she didn’t care.

Gwen’s tears flowed uncontrollably, wetting Laina’s pale face as she pressed the small body to her chest.

Her heart stopped for a moment when she felt a faint pulse from her daughter’s chest.

“Sweetheart, Mom knows you won’t leave me…” Her tears began to flow freely again.

In a panic, she laid Laina down on the cold tile floor of the bathroom, then began compressing her daughter’s chest to perform CPR.

“Please, Laina… come back to me…”

Cough!

Laina’s tiny body suddenly jerked. Her little chest rose and fell roughly as a spurt of warm water came up from her throat. Laina coughed with all her might, inhaling the cold night air into her lungs, which had momentarily stopped working.

“Mommy ... M-Mom...” The voice was very weak, almost a whisper, but to Gwen, it was the most beautiful sound she had ever heard in her entire life.

Laina’s drooping eyes slowly opened, staring intently at her mother. Though her lips still bore a bluish tint, the warmth of life began to creep back into her skin.

“Oh my God... Thank you...” Gwen immediately scooped up Laina’s body, holding her so tightly as if afraid her daughter would be snatched away if she let go.

“Mom, Laina’s scared…” Laina’s sobs broke out in Gwen’s embrace. Her body was shivering violently from the cold.

Gwen kept whispering soothing words, assuring her daughter—and herself—that this nightmare would end.

“Don’t worry, Sweetheart, Mom won’t let this place torment you anymore,” Gwen whispered softly.

Her heart was resolved, fueled by vengeance, to make Darius regret it.

Carrying Laina and holding her daughter’s head close so she couldn’t look around, Gwen made her way toward the kitchen.

She grabbed a gas can and poured it without hesitation all over the living room.

Standing in the front doorway, Gwen struck a match. “Goodbye, Darius,” she whispered . She dropped the lit match onto the floor, already soaked in gasoline.

Whoosh!

The flames licked rapidly, devouring the curtains, creeping up the walls, and greedily consuming the entire house. The heat spread, driving away the cold.

Gwen didn’t look back. She stepped out onto the porch, walking away from the house as it crumbled, consumed by the fire.
